Chimney Rebuilding to Improve Home Safety and Efficiency
Chimney rebuilding is a specialized process that restores the structural integrity and safety of deteriorated or damaged chimneys. Properly maintained chimneys are essential for safe venting of smoke and gases from fireplaces and heating appliances. Regular inspections can identify issues such as cracks, leaning, or deterioration that may require rebuilding to prevent hazards.

Duration of Chimney Rebuilding by Professionals
A professional chimney rebuild typically takes between one to three days, depending on the extent of the damage and the complexity of the structure. Accurate assessment and efficient work ensure minimal disruption while restoring safety and functionality.
The Rebuilding Process Explained
The process begins with a comprehensive inspection to evaluate the condition of the chimney. Damaged bricks, mortar, or liners are carefully removed. New materials are then installed, including bricks, mortar, and liners, to reinforce the structure. Final inspections confirm the stability and safety of the rebuilt chimney.
